ABOUT THE ORIGINAL BOOK
“Eleanor & Park” by Rainbow Rowell is a poignant story about two high school sophomores, Eleanor, an awkward, red-haired girl with a troubled home life, and Park, a quiet, half-Korean boy struggling with his own identity. Set in 1986, their unlikely bond begins on the bus, where they bond over music, comics, and shared feelings of isolation. As their relationship deepens, they navigate the complexities of young love, bullying, family struggles, and self-discovery. The novel explores themes of belonging, personal growth, and the impact of love and friendship, set against the backdrop of emotional and physical challenges.
